Lineage plasticity refers to the ability of cancer cells, particularly in prostate cancer, to alter their characteristics in response to therapy, leading to resistance and treatment failure. This phenomenon is increasingly recognized as a significant barrier to effective treatment. Clinicians are faced with patients whose cancer progresses despite conventional therapies, often manifesting through low prostate-specific antigen (PSA) levels and resistance to androgen receptor (AR) inhibitors. To address the challenges posed by lineage plasticity in prostate cancer, researchers emphasize the need for several key advancements. Understanding how lineage plasticity occurs, identifying emerging drivers of the process, and developing preclinical models that accurately represent disease biology are critical steps. Moreover, identifying therapeutic targets and designing innovative clinical trials are essential to improving patient outcomes. Here are three actionable pieces of advice to implement in your own learning and knowledge management:

  1. Create a Layered Note-Taking System: Begin with detailed notes when reading or learning something new. As time passes, revisit these notes and distill them into concise summaries or key takeaways. This layered approach not only reinforces your understanding but also makes it easier to retrieve and apply information when needed.

  2. Regularly Review and Update Knowledge: Schedule periodic reviews of your notes and summaries. This practice ensures that your understanding remains current and that you can adapt your knowledge as new information or insights emerge, much like how cancer cells evolve in response to treatment pressures.

  3. Foster Curiosity and Exploration: Encourage a habit of questioning and seeking deeper knowledge about the subjects that matter to you. Whether it’s investigating the latest research in prostate cancer or understanding a concept you read about, nurturing curiosity can lead to greater insights and more robust knowledge systems.
